Man, I test drove this car today Thanks a lot for the advise, it was surprisingly a great experience.

The car felt quick, handling is nice too.

Obviously, it’s not as refined as Supra: transmission is slow in D mode, engine boost kick is not that aggressive as b58 engine.

But definitely more space inside, much better visibility as well. Siting position is better

The only downside, which I felt are the seats. They are like hard bucket seats and they are a little too narrow for me (I’m 195 and almost 100 kg). Also there is no way to adjust the seat height, which is weird

So it felt like a sport coupe rather then sport car like Supra

With the Supra seating position is more sporty (you have less width in your legs and you seat lower to the ground). While seats themselves are great and comfortable

Now I need to understand what is worse: - seating position in a Supra - or bucket seats in 400Z
